Transaction 9222a78fb5309a8129a0a8cdf14ec21988d96fcdd8c5f7de76d9fe068c23ccee

1 Input
1 Outputs
  • 9222a78fb5309a8129a0a8cdf14ec21988d96fcdd8c5f7de76d9fe068c23ccee:0
  • value  308882
    address  3GFEfoZSdBCKDZgc7sv4K9eR8PW9eBPGYj